What does an associate data engineer do?

An Associate Data Engineer is responsible for supporting the development, maintenance, and optimization of data pipelines and databases. They work closely with senior data engineers and other IT professionals to ensure data is accessible, reliable, and efficiently processed for analytics and business use. Typical tasks include writing and testing code for data integration, troubleshooting data issues, and implementing data security best practices. This entry-level position is a foundational role that builds technical skills and experience in data engineering.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an associate data engineer?

To thrive as an Associate Data Engineer, you need a solid understanding of data modeling, SQL, Python, and foundational knowledge of database concepts, often backed by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with data warehousing tools (like AWS Redshift, Google BigQuery), ETL frameworks, and cloud platforms as well as industry certifications such as AWS Certified Data Analytics is beneficial.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ication help you navigate complex data challenges and collaborate with teams. These abilities are crucial for ensuring data systems are reliable, scalable, and aligned with organizational goals.

What are some common challenges an associate data engineer may face when working with large-scale data pipelines?

As an Associate Data Engineer, you may often encounter challenges such as optimizing data pipeline performance, ensuring data quality, and troubleshooting bottlenecks when processing large volumes of data. Working with distributed systems can introduce complex issues like latency and data consistency. Collaborating effectively with data scientists, analysts, and senior engineers is crucial for aligning data infrastructure with evolving project requirements. Regularly learning new tools and best practices will help you adapt to these challenges and grow in your role.

Is an associate data engineer entry level?

An associate data engineer is typically an entry-level position suitable for candidates with limited professional experience in data engineering. It often requires foundational skills in SQL, Python, or cloud platforms and serves as a starting point for a career in data engineering.

Job description

As an Associate Data Engineer at Gore Mutual Insurance, you have a strong technical background in software engineering / computer science and will be responsible for building, and maintaining our data platform. Your work will facilitate data accessibility, accuracy, and accountability, enabling data-driven decision-making across our organization. You will collaborate closely with cross-functional teams to ensure our data processes are robust and scalable.

What will you be doing in this role?

Developing Systems for Collecting and Storing Data

  • Build data pipelines and technical components

Automating Data Management Processes and Handling Data Security

  • Automated data management processes.
  • Follow security protocols and best practices to protect against potential security threats.

Testing and Optimizing Data Pipelines

  • Optimize data pipelines to ensure efficient data flow.
  • Ensure that the data extracted from sources is accurate, complete, and usable. This might involve checking for missing values, inconsistent formats, or anomalies that could indicate errors.
  • Test the efficiency and speed of data pipelines and databases. This can help identify bottlenecks and optimize performance.
  • Verify that different components of the data infrastructure work together as expected. This includes checking that data flows correctly from sources to databases, and from databases to applications.

Maintenance of Data Pipelines

  • Regularly check the health and performance of the data processes.
  • Identify and resolve issues including debugging code, optimizing queries, or adjusting configurations.

What will you need to succeed in this role?

  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Computer Science, Data Engineering, Software Engineering or a related field.
  • A minimum of 1-3 years of relevant experience as a data engineer is required. This includes experience in data engineering, data system development, or related roles.
  • Good understanding of data structures, data modeling, and SQL.
  • Exposure to Cloud based Services, preferably Microsoft Azure.
  • Understanding with software design patterns and test-driven development (TDD)
  • Proficiency in one programming language, preferably Python, including a strong grasp of Object Oriented and Functional programming paradigms.
  • Exposure to Apache Spark concepts and distributed systems, including data transformations, RDDs, DataFrames, and Spark SQL.
  • Strong problem-solving and critical-thinking abilities.
  • Strong communication and collaboration skills.
